What food can I make and sell from home
People who manufacture food at home can only sell low-risk foods such as coffee and tea blends, dry foods such as granola, chips and popcorn, baked goods such as breads, cookies and some cakes, and jams and preserves.
Can you start a takeaway from home
You’ll need to get a licence for any premises where you carry out food operations, even if they’re temporary. So, if you prepare food at home and sell it from a stall at the local market, you’ll need a licence for your home and a licence for your booth.
How much can you make baking from home
If you’re just taking special orders, the bakers estimated you can earn between $200 and $400 per month; if you’re working 20 hours per week, $800 to $1,200; and if you start baking lots of wedding cakes, much, much more. There’s one thing both of the home bakers I spoke with emphasized: the power of word-of-mouth.
Do I need to register my cake business
When you start a new food business, or take over an existing business, you will need to register with your local authority. You should do this at least 28 days before opening. Registration of your food business is free and can’t be refused. Registration is simple and will take a matter of minutes.
Can I bake cakes at home and sell them
If you’re planning to sell your baked goods anywhere other than farmers markets, your home kitchen will likely be classified as a commercial bakery. … If you plan to have customers come to your home to pick up baked goods, or if you plan to put up signs, you may also need city permits.
How can I legally sell my homemade products
Homemade or handmade products must meet FDA rules and regulations, but they must also meet state-specific Cottage Food Laws as well. Before you begin prepping your homemade items for selling to the public, get familiar with your state’s Cottage Food Laws to ensure that you’re able to sell homemade items publicly.
How much do homemade cakes sell for
For tiered cakes, they generally start at $4.50 per serving for 2 tiers and the price increases per tier (by $. 25 per tier, so a 4 tiered cake would be a minimum $4.50 per serving) and for difficulty/design. A 5″ + 7″ round tiered cake with 26 servings is $120 minimum, plus taxes.

Do I need a food hygiene certificate to sell sweets
In the UK, food handlers don’t have to hold a food hygiene certificate to prepare or sell food.

Do I need insurance to sell cakes from home
Take out home business insurance Public liability insurance and product liability insurance (usually sold together) can cover you if someone becomes ill after eating one of your cakes, or if you accidentally damage a customer’s property when delivering your cakes. … Ashburnham Insurance Services.
Do you need a food hygiene certificate to sell cakes from home
While a food hygiene certificate isn’t compulsory it is strongly recommended by the Food Standards Agency (FSA) and other official bodies. … Like larger food businesses, food hygiene and safety is just as important when you are selling cakes from home.
